Top 5 Film & Television Apps on iOS in Israel Q1 2024
Discover the performance of the top 5 Film & Television apps on iOS in Israel during Q1 2024,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
The first quarter of 2024 saw notable performances from the top 5 Film & Television apps on iOS in Israel. Here's a closer look at their tr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
Disney+ experienced a steady increase in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$33.9K in mid-March. Weekly downloads were relatively stable, hovering around the 2.8K mark throughout the quarter. The app's weekly active users fluctuated slightly but remained consistent, ending the quarter with around 48K users.
Netflix showed a varied revenue trend, with a notable peak of $21.8K in mid-March. Weekly downloads saw a high of 6.1K in mid-February, while weekly active users experienced a slight decline, closing the quarter at approximately 138K users.
Shahid - ﺷﺎﻫﺪ saw significant growth in revenue, peaking at $25.4K in early March. Downloads spiked to 8.5K in the same period. Active users also saw an upward trend, reaching a peak of 21.2K in early March before settling at around 19.7K by the end of the quarter.
Amazon Prime Video maintained a steady revenue stream, with a peak of $9K in mid-March. Weekly downloads remained modest, averaging around 1K throughout the quarter. The app’s active users fluctuated slightly, ending the quarter with about 6.4K users.
ReelShort - Short Movie & TV saw a significant revenue increase, reaching $7.6K in mid-March. Downloads peaked at 2.9K in late February, and active users showed a rising trend, peaking at 6.6K in late March.
